My Enemy Is Me Poem by Jason R Tschetter

My Enemy Is Me



<My heart sinks when I hear her say his name
a single breath about him burns me within
I promised not to hold my heart for her
But in truth I can not hold that promise
There is deep within me a longing for her
the sweet duress of her kiss
the passion within her song of days
and the heat of her body in the lust of night
I wish I was there with her day after day
But in truth she feels something different
She wants not me
But lusts for another
Why is this my life
Why is this my way
What will become of me
What should befall me
I am alone in this world
So I stand alone
Feeling this burning inside me
I'm my own enemy>
